Description
Overview of the medicine
Novonil 10 mg Tablet contains Norethisterone, a synthetic progestin hormone. It is primarily used for managing various menstrual disorders, endometriosis, and as a component in hormone replacement therapy. It can also be used to delay periods.

Dosage
Adults
Dosage varies greatly depending on the indication. For dysfunctional uterine bleeding: 5-10 mg daily for 10 days. For delaying periods: 5 mg three times daily starting 3 days before expected period. For endometriosis: 10 mg daily for 6-9 months.
Elderly
Caution is advised; lower doses may be necessary. Use under medical supervision.
Renal_impairment
No specific dose adjustment guidelines; use with caution.
How to Take
Take orally with water. Can be taken with or without food. Follow the physician's instructions regarding dose and duration strictly.
Mechanism of Action
Norethisterone acts similarly to natural progesterone, primarily by transforming the proliferative endometrium into a secretory endometrium. It suppresses ovulation, thickens cervical mucus, and thins the endometrial lining, depending on the dosage and indication.
Pharmacokinetics
Onset
Effects on endometrium typically begin within hours to days.
Excretion
Mainly via urine (50-70%) and feces (30-40%) as metabolites.
Half life
Approximately 5-13 hours.
Absorption
Well absorbed orally, with peak plasma concentrations occurring within 1-2 hours.
Metabolism
Extensively metabolized in the liver, primarily by reduction and hydroxylation, followed by sulfation and glucuronidation.

Contraindications
- Known or suspected pregnancy
- Undiagnosed vaginal bleeding
- Severe liver disease or tumors
- History of thrombophlebitis or thromboembolic disorders
- Hypersensitivity to Norethisterone or any components
Drug Interactions
Warfarin
May alter anticoagulant effect; monitor INR.
Ciclosporin
May increase plasma levels of ciclosporin.
Rifampicin, Carbamazepine, Phenytoin
May reduce the effectiveness of Norethisterone by increasing its metabolism.
Storage
Store below 30°C in a dry place, away from light and moisture. Keep out of reach of children.
Overdose
Symptoms of overdose include nausea, vomiting, breast tenderness, and vaginal bleeding. Treatment is symptomatic and supportive. No specific antidote.
Pregnancy & Lactation
Contraindicated during pregnancy. Avoid use during lactation as it can pass into breast milk and may affect breastfed infants and milk production.

Lab Monitoring
- Periodic physical examination including breast and pelvic examination
- Blood pressure monitoring
- Liver function tests (if signs of hepatic dysfunction)
- Coagulation parameters (if history of thromboembolic events)
Doctor Notes
- Advise patients on potential for irregular bleeding, especially during initial cycles.
- Educate patients about non-contraceptive use of this drug.
- Consider patient's cardiovascular risk factors before prescribing, especially for long-term use.
Patient Guidelines
- Take medicine exactly as prescribed.
- Report any unusual bleeding or severe side effects immediately.
- Do not stop taking the medicine without consulting your doctor.
- This medicine does not protect against sexually transmitted infections.
Missed Dose Advice
If a dose is missed, take it as soon as you remember, unless it is almost time for your next dose. In that case, skip the missed dose and continue with your regular schedule. Do not double the dose.
Driving Precautions
Norethisterone generally does not affect the ability to drive or operate machinery. However, if you experience dizziness or visual disturbances, avoid such activities.
